Adding to my collection, uh I mean setup.... I am building an improvised DJ setup for traktor pro 2. I have a:

Macbook 13" with Traktor Pro 2

Vestax Typhoon

DJ Hero wii controller running midi over bluetooth through OSCulator

Rock Band 3 Wii Keyboard with a midi to usb cable (mapped to cue points and effects)

behringer xenyx 502 mixer

rokit 5 monitor

bose sounddock (with female ipod to male 3.5mm)

marshall guitar amp.

This is my improvised ghetto setup until I get some real gear. Let me know what you believe!!!!DSC00711.jpgDSC00695.jpgDSC00698.jpgDSC00701.jpgDSC00715.jpgDSC00714.jpgDSC00705.jpg
